Albert vs Conversion.ai (Copy.ai)
Which Is Better in 2026?
Quick Verdict
Albert and Conversion.ai serve different but complementary purposes in digital advertising. Albert is a comprehensive campaign automation and optimization platform ideal for businesses managing large-scale paid advertising across multiple channels, while Conversion.ai is a copywriting tool designed to rapidly generate marketing content for ads, emails, and landing pages. Albert suits advertisers focused on campaign performance optimization, whereas Conversion.ai is better for marketing teams needing to produce high volumes of ad copy and creative variations quickly.

Pros & Cons
Albert
Pros
- Automates time-consuming bid and budget management tasks
- Multi-channel campaign optimization across search, social, and display
- Machine learning continuously improves performance over time
- Reduces need for large dedicated marketing operations teams
Cons
- High pricing not accessible for small businesses or startups
- Requires significant setup and historical data for optimal performance
- Learning curve and integration complexity with existing systems
Conversion.ai (Copy.ai)
Pros
- User-friendly interface with drag-and-drop functionality
- Extensive template library for multiple content types
- Fast content generation across bulk projects
- Affordable pricing with free tier options
Cons
- Output quality varies and often requires human editing
- Limited industry-specific customization
- May generate repetitive or generic phrasing
Conclusion
Choose Albert if your primary need is automating and optimizing existing ad campaigns across Google, Facebook, and other platforms while maximizing ROI through machine learning. Select Conversion.ai if your bottleneck is creating ad copy, email content, and landing page text at scale, and you have the team to refine and optimize generated content. For maximum impact, many marketing organizations use both tools together—Conversion.ai to generate copy variations and Albert to optimize their performance across paid channels.
